Hi, and welcome aboard. You're taking over release duties for the ParcelPing parcel-tracking webhook service. Deploys go out Tuesdays after the carrier-feed sync completes; never ship mid-sync or retries pile up. The webhook payloads are signed so downstream shops can verify delivery events — if the signature drifts, every integration partner starts rejecting updates at once, so treat this carefully. Rotation happens quarterly; next one is already scheduled. The active signing key you'll need is below.

deploy key for tajep-fahif: bky19_Hsbh6jHLfHtPXqpEhcy

Quarterly Planning Note — Franchise Deal, Pellago Coffee Works

Sales leads: quick heads-up. The franchise agreement with the Marrowgate group is nearly signed — three locations in year one, option for five more. Training kits ship next month; keep pipeline forecasts separate until ink is dry. Questions to regional ops, please. The thinking behind the deal terms is summarized below.

internal memo for kaduf-baduf: Only 35 of the 378 pilot accounts renewed Holir, so a churn review is set for June 11. Eliielax Group is in early talks to buy Silaelix Group for about $142.1 million.

## Support

Canary gating for the Driftgate deploy pipeline: promotion requires error rate <0.5% over 30 minutes, p95 latency within 10% of baseline, and zero failed health probes. Overrides need two approvals and a ticket reference. Gating rules live in gates.yaml; do not edit in place — submit a change through review. Historical override decisions are logged in the pipeline audit. Questions about gating behavior or overrides go to the maintainers below.

billing contact of yawip-yadup = druath.casdor@nelvrolabs.internal

Rotated signing key for the StockTally inventory reconciliation job. Trigger: scheduled 60-day rotation, no compromise indicators. Old key revoked immediately; grace period not required since the job runs single-tenant. Scope unchanged: artifact signing only, no runtime secrets affected. Verified: reconciliation run on the Drell warehouse dataset completed with valid signatures. Audit log entries filed under the Q3 rotation ticket. Next rotation due in 60 days. The active signing key for review is as follows.

deploy key for kajof-fajop: bky6_gDHw9Q